Shadow World
Speaking of Haalkitaine, Terry finished the remaining new adventures. Simultaneously the RMSS stats have been arriving in waves for inclusion in the new sourcebook. Layout is done bar the RMSS pages and the TOC.
Meanwhile Terry has been working on another mini-adventure. Once he finishes that, he will return to Emer IV.

HARP Fantasy and HARP SF
Lots of artwork has now been commissioned for HARP Subterfuge with more still to allocate. Some pieces have already arrived.
Colin has generated the artwork list for HARP Garden of Rain and is starting to commission that art too. Joel has already sent over some excellent maps.
On HARP Bestiary, I have completed my work on the expanded Base Movement Rate table (swimmers, flyers, quadrupeds and multilegged creatures move at different rates to normal bipeds) and you guessed it, I have sent it over to Colin who has already produced an artwork list.
I have now moved on to the revised version of HARP Beyond the Veil – Jon Cassie made various additions at my request so I have a modest editing sweep to perform.
My queue is therefore now HARP Beyond the Veil, Cyradon, Priest-King and RMU.
